简介
ws-client-link
是一个基于 WebSocket 协议的 npm 包,用于在前端创建 WebSocket 连接,并在连接后使用该连接进行实时通信。本文将介绍该包的安装、使用、示例代码及指导意义。
安装
在命令行中运行以下命令以安装 ws-client-link
:
npm install ws-client-link
使用
首先,在你的前端应用程序中引入 ws-client-link
:
import WebSocketClientLink from 'ws-client-link'
然后,创建一个新的 WebSocketClientLink
实例,将服务器的地址传递给它:
const link = new WebSocketClientLink('ws://yourserver.com')
接下来,使用 link.connect()
方法连接到服务器:
link.connect()
现在,你已经连接到了服务器!你可以使用 link.send(message)
方法向服务器发送消息,并使用 link.on('message', callback)
事件监听器接收服务器发送的消息。
示例代码
以下是一个完整的示例代码,其中客户端向服务器发送一条消息,然后服务器返回一条响应消息。
-- -------------------- ---- ------- ------ ------------------- ---- ---------------- ----- ---- - --- ------------------------------------------ --------------- -- -- - -------------------- ---------------- --------- -- ------------------ ------- -- - -------------------- -------- -- --------------
指导意义
使用 ws-client-link
可以帮助前端开发人员快速、方便地创建 WebSocket 连接,并实现实时通信。这对于实现实时应用程序(如即时聊天、即时采购等)非常有用。除此之外,本文还介绍了如何安装、使用该包,以及示例代码,供读者参考。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/600562e481e8991b448e077d